TENNIS
AUSTRALIA LEADING JAPAN
(Australian Press Association.)
SYDNEY. February IP.
The tennis 'lest. Japan versus Australia, was continued to-day in perfect weather. Results were: Singles.—llopmaii beat Nun»i 26, (> 2; Sprmile heat Harmla o—4, (I _:s; Crawlerd heat SatohO- J, 1- 0, 6 3.’
I hail !es.— llopnian a.ml Sprmile heat Mura da and N iilioi (3 I. A ■ fi --F The total scores now are:--Aus-tralia : Six rubbers, 13 sets, 103 games; Japan : Two rubbers, eight sets, 90 games. The Test concludes to-morrow.
Critics declare Satoli’s speed against Crawford to-day was never eclipsed in lirst class tennis in Australia. He laid a great, crowd on the tip too of excitement.
